    Wordle Analysis

    Every day I check Wordle Bot to help analyze my guessing game. You can check your Wordles with Wordle Bot right here.

    I guessed SPINE today because I just visited a spinal doctor and learned that I have something called Scheuermann’s Disease, which isn’t as bad as it’s spelled but also isn’t great. SPINE, however, was a pretty great opening guess. With 31 words left, I decided to try all new letters on guess #2. ABORT slashed the remaining number down to just two: PLATE or TAUPE. I almost went with PLATE, but decided to be bold and guess the less likely of the two. I’m glad I did. TAUPE was the Wordle! Huzzah for me!

    How To Play Competitive Wordle

    • Guessing in 1 is worth 3 points; guessing in 2 is worth 2 points; guessing in 3 is worth 1 point; guessing in 4 is worth 0 points; guessing in 5 is -1 points; guessing in 6 is -2 points and missing the Wordle is -3 points.
    • If you beat your opponent you get 1 point. If you tie, you get 0 points. And if you lose to your opponent, you get -1 point. Add it up to get your score. Keep a daily running score or just play for a new score each day.
    • Fridays are 2XP, meaning you double your points—positive or negative.
    • You can keep a running tally or just play day-by-day. Enjoy!

    Today’s Wordle Etymology

    The word “taupe” comes from the French word taupe, meaning “mole” (the animal). It originally referred to the grayish-brown color of a mole’s fur. The French word itself derives from Latin talpa, also meaning “mole.” The word was first used in English in the late 19th century, as a color name.
